When my 2 pups were 10 weeks old, I paid $7 or $8 for a bottle of rabbit scent. I dragged a scent flavored rag around the neighborhood, up into the woods and finally hung it up in a tree. The pups followed right on the trail all the way to the tree then looked up at the rag. Training complete, no where to go from there. Like everyone else says, it's a waste of hard earned buckage.
